<h3 id="requirements-for-registered-agents" id="requirements-for-registered-agents">Requirements for Registered Agents</h3>

<p>When establishing a business entity, understanding the registered agent requirements is essential for compliance. Most states mandate that all corporations and limited liability companies appoint a designated agent to receive service of process and additional legal correspondence. A registered agent must be a resident of the state where the business is formed or a corporation authorized to function in the state. This provides that there is a reliable contact person for formal communications.</p>

<p>In addition to being a resident, registered agents are demanded to keep regular business hours to accept service of process. This capability is crucial, as it ensures the prompt handling of legal documents, which, if ignored, could lead to major legal repercussions for the business. Firms should also be aware of specific state regulations governing the requirements of registered agents, as these can differ considerably between jurisdictions.</p>

<p>Organizations must provide documents with the state to designate their registered agent, often requiring an change of agent form as part of the process. Compliance with these regulations generally involves annual updates or maintenance to keep the registered agent information current. Ensuring adherence to these requirements not only helps with regulatory obligations but also promotes in keeping good standing with state authorities.</p>

<h3 id="the-way-to-modify-the-registered-agent" id="the-way-to-modify-the-registered-agent">The way to Modify The Registered Agent</h3>

<p>Changing the registered agent represents a simple process, but it does involve multiple important steps to guarantee compliance with state regulations. To begin with, you need to choose a new registered agent provider that satisfies the business needs, providing reliability and affordability. It is crucial to investigate several registered agent services, focusing on elements such as their accessibility, service offerings, and customer feedback to find the most suitable fit for your organization.</p>

<p>Once you have chosen a new registered agent, the following step is to formally initiate the change. This typically involves completing a registered agent change form provided by the Secretary of State office or relevant regulatory body. Many states require you to send this form along with any required fees, commonly referred to as registered agent renewal fees or change fees. Make sure to keep a copy of the submission for the records.</p>

<p>Once submitting the change request, confirm that the new registered agent is formally recognized by the state. This can usually be done through the state’s digital registered agent directory or by requesting confirmation from your different agent. Make certain that you also inform your previous registered agent of the change to avoid any potential interruptions in service, particularly regarding important legal documents and compliance notifications.</p>
